Abstract

The utility model discloses a tire temperature and pressure monitoring adapter, which comprises a winding barrel, wherein the inner wall of the winding barrel is laminated with an electric wire, the right end of the electric wire is electrically connected with a butt joint structure, the right end of the butt joint structure is electrically connected with the plug, the left side wall of the plug is fixedly provided with the ball body, the side wall of the ball body is respectively jointed with the first ring body and the second ring body, the right side wall of the first ring body is provided with a first through hole, the right side wall of the second ring body is provided with a threaded hole, the inner wall of the first through hole is inserted with a screw, the inner wall of the threaded hole is screwed with the side wall of the screw, the device is inserted with an external socket at an angle capable of being smoothly inserted, the position and angle of the monitor can be adjusted after the plug-in connection, the interference with other external charging equipment is reduced, the spiral elasticity of the electric wire is arranged, make this device also can expand and make the monitor can arrange in farther place and place the charging, given more choices of user, avoided the electric wire of overlength to cause simultaneously and accomodate inconvenient purpose.

Detailed Description

Referring to fig. 1-3, the present invention provides a technical solution: a tire temperature and tire pressure monitoring adapter comprises a winding barrel 1, an electric wire 2 is attached to the inner wall of the winding barrel 1, the right end of the electric wire 2 is electrically connected with a butt joint structure 3, the right end of the butt joint structure 3 is electrically connected with a plug 4, a ball 5 is fixedly installed on the left side wall of the plug 4, the side wall of the ball 5 is respectively attached to a first ring body 6 and a second ring body 7, the right side wall of the first ring body 6 is provided with a first through hole 601, the right side wall of the second ring body 7 is provided with a threaded hole 701, an inner wall of the first through hole 601 is inserted with a screw 8, the inner wall of the threaded hole 701 is screwed with the screw 8, the device is electrically connected with an external socket through the plug, the electric wire is spirally and elastically arranged and is convenient to unfold and store, the electric wire is electrically connected with an external tire temperature and tire pressure monitoring instrument, the side wall of the ball is smoothly processed by adopting a grinding process, the screw is screwed with the threaded hole, the first ring body is pressed to be matched with the second ring body to clamp and fix the ball, two second through holes are arranged.
Specifically, the guide rod 9 is fixedly installed on the inner wall of the first through hole 601, the second through hole 702 is formed in the right side wall of the second ring body 7, the inner wall of the second through hole 702 is attached to the side wall of the guide rod 9, the second through hole is inserted into the guide rod, and therefore the position of the first ring body relative to the second ring body is aligned, and clamping instability of a sphere caused by a difference deviation is avoided.
